PROJECT PROFILE WJE www.wje.com Tiger and Sloth Bear Exhibit Evaluation of Gunite Faux Rock Themework | Cleveland, OH CLIENT Van Auken Akins Architects, LLC BACKGROUND The tiger and sloth bear exhibit at the Cleveland Metroparks Zoo includes gunite faux rock walls that divide the exhibits and conceal elements such as the moat wall, animal holding facility, and access points. The tiger enclosure was constructed circa 1961, while the sloth bear enclosure was constructed as an addition. Gunite is a pneumatically-applied concrete, also known as dry- method shotcrete.
